Output d11a07da1549eb39d8ee370345e4128b9bdd4c88b5e28fb3a754eb89ec880e07:3

value
65632694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e31cd907ce30c609cebd0fb654aff36c918e7732 OP_EQUAL
address
3NPssU62puTS9fkhpSSaSQuLRLGypMUqWv
transaction
d11a07da1549eb39d8ee370345e4128b9bdd4c88b5e28fb3a754eb89ec880e07
confirmations
255405
spent
true